SUPER ATHLETE SPINACH SMOOTHIES

After a run or a workout, this hearty smoothie will refresh and restore, with its combination of spinach, Greek yogurt, avocado and berries.

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Breakfast

Time 8m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 box (9 oz) frozen chopped spinach
1 container (6 oz) Greek Fat Free blueberry yogurt
1 avocado half, pitted and peeled
3/4 cup cranberry-blueberry juice
1/2 cup Cascadian Farm® frozen organic blueberries

Steps:

  • Microwave spinach as directed on box. Rinse with cold water until cooled. Drain, squeezing out as much liquid as possible.
  • In blender, place 1/4 cup of the cooked spinach and remaining ingredients. (Cover and refrigerate remaining spinach for another use.) Cover; blend on high speed about 30 seconds or until smooth.
  • Pour into 2 glasses. Serve immediately.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 230, Carbohydrate 36 g, Cholesterol 5 mg, Fat 1, Fiber 5 g, Protein 8 g, SaturatedFat 1 g, ServingSize 1 Serving, Sodium 75 mg, Sugar 19 g, TransFat 0 g
